Fancy a high tea with one of the best views in Brisbane? Patina at Customs House is serving up tasty tiered bites and bubbles for $88 per person every Tuesday to Sunday.

Indulge in a 1.5 hour high tea session that includes a sumptuous selection of bites, French tea, barista-made coffee and a glass of Taittinger Champagne.

Sink your teeth into a range of savoury snacks including smoked salmon on blinis with sour cream and salmon pearls, poached chicken, dill and watercress sandwiches, coronation egg with chive and beetroot cone, capsicum, eggplant, zucchini, basil and goats cheese roulade, mini Queensland spanner crab and celery bun, and warm gruyere and leek tart with roasted cherry tomato.

Sweet tooths can finish off the feasting festivities with some raspberry scones with jam, cream and fresh raspberries, macarons and an assortment of handmade petite desserts.

You can experience this lavish high tea on Tuesday's at 3pm and from Wednesday to Sunday at 11am or 3pm. 

Need to know: Bookings for Patina's Champagne High Tea are essential and 24 hours notice is required.
